A control cable is a multi-core electrical cable designed to transmit control signals, measurement data, and low-voltage power between devices in industrial systems. Unlike power cables that primarily deliver high electrical loads, control cables focus on accuracy, stability, and reliable signal transmission.
In practical terms, control cable acts as the communication backbone between sensors, actuators, control panels, motors, and automated machinery. Without reliable control cable infrastructure, modern industrial automation simply cannot function.

The working principle of a control cable is based on stable electrical signal transmission between two or more connected components. Each conductor inside the cable carries a specific signal or control command.
In industrial environments filled with electromagnetic interference, temperature fluctuations, and mechanical stress, a properly designed control cable ensures consistent system response and precise control.
Understanding the internal structure of a control cable helps explain why material quality and manufacturing standards matter so much.
| Component | Function | Importance |
|---|---|---|
| Conductor | Transmits electrical signals | Determines conductivity and flexibility |
| Insulation | Separates conductors | Prevents short circuits |
| Shielding | Reduces EMI interference | Ensures signal accuracy |
| Sheath | External protection | Resists abrasion and chemicals |
Each layer contributes to the overall reliability of the control cable, especially in demanding industrial conditions.
